Re: Retirement of the Stonebriar product line

Stonebriar sales have declined for five consecutive quarters and support costs now exceed contribution margin. The retirement plan is staged: new orders close end of Q2, existing contracts honoured through their terms, and spares stocked for twenty-four months. Sales leads should steer prospects toward the Ashgrove range; migration incentives are already approved. Customer comms are drafted and awaiting legal sign-off. The forward strategy behind this decision is set out in the note below.

confidential, yafog-hagug: Gross margin on Druix came in at 10 percent against a plan of 15 percent. Only 5 of the 80 pilot accounts renewed Druix, so a churn review is set for October 1.

Adds the order-cutoff rule for Millbrae Hearth's online bakery. Orders past the cutoff roll to the next bake day; weekend cutoffs shift earlier. Logic lives in one module so ops can adjust without redeploying the storefront. Tested against the holiday calendar through next year. Flagging for the eng sync since fulfillment timing changes. Cutoff and buffer constants are defined below.

tuning table, yajog-yahof:
BUDGETS = {
    "lamvan": 303,
    "wenox": 460,
    "fenvan": 525,
}

## Authentication

Heads up, reviewer: the Larkspine reminder job pings the clinic scheduling service every morning at 06:00 and needs its own credential — it can't reuse the web app's token. The job reads it from the env at startup and fails loudly if it's missing. For local runs against the staging scheduler, use the key below.

API key for tajog-bajof: kto15_6fvgvYZbOKdLifh

- [ ] Step 7: Archive cold storage buckets (Glacierline tier). Confirm both ceremony witnesses are present, verify bucket manifests match the Oxbow ledger, then seal the archive key shares. Plugin authors may observe but not handle shares. Once sealed, the archive index itself is encrypted and can only be reopened with the passphrase below.

vault phrase of badup-hahig = tamael-aldael-kelmir-istael-fenok-istwyn-tamius-jorath-oliion